WebMar 1, 2024 · Tip 1: Identify the sources of stress in your life Tip 2: Practice the 4 A's of stress management Tip 3: Get moving Tip 4: Connect to others Tip 5: Make time for fun and relaxation Tip 6: Manage your time better Tip 7: Maintain balance with a healthy lifestyle Tip 8: Learn to relieve stress in the moment The importance of managing stress WebJun 29, 2024 · A great way of managing stress is through socializing. Socialization helps relieve stress by promoting the hormone oxytocin which promotes relaxation, thus reducing anxiety. Playing a sport, mainly a team sport, gives you the opportunity to make new friends who share a common interest. Being around others who share a mutual goal motivates you.
